### Turnstile Counter Recovery — GateSum Service

If the turnstile counter at Harrowfield Arena drifts from the physical tally, restart the GateSum aggregator before attempting a manual reconciliation. The aggregator replays the last hour of gate events from the buffer, so no counts are lost on restart. Reviewers checking this procedure should verify the replay window setting matches the event retention period. To query the aggregator's admin endpoint during verification, use the internal key below.

gateway credential: kto3_qfe

## Changelog — Font vendoring defaults changed

As of this release, the Bracken UI build no longer fetches third-party fonts at build time. All typefaces used by the Lanternwell suite are now vendored into the repo under a dedicated assets directory, and the fetch step is skipped by default. If you're onboarding, nothing to install — the fonts travel with the checkout. The build flags controlling this behavior are listed below.

settings of hadup-yafog:
LAMAEL_PIN=3761
LAMAEL_TENANT=istmir
LAMAEL_METRICS_HOST=metrics.lamael.plorvasys.test
LAMAEL_SEAL=seal_8ea68500
LAMAEL_STANDBY_TEAM=fraok

**14:22 — Timetable solver stalls (Brightmoor pilot)**

Heads up, support folks: at 14:22 the Slatewing solver stopped emitting schedules for the Brightmoor pilot district and just spun on the constraint pass. Turned out a malformed room-capacity import made the solver think every classroom held zero students, so no assignment was ever feasible. We rolled back the import at 14:51 and schedules started flowing again. If parents or admins ask, reference the affected run by the trace token below.

session token of bawep-yadup = htk21_528abd376e3c5a4ec24a1

Finance Review Summary — Brindlemoor Supply Renewal

Welcome aboard — here's the short version before your first review. Our agreement with Brindlemoor Packaging runs out in October. They've been reliable, but their renewal quote is about 6% above last year, and we think there's room to negotiate given our volumes doubled. Ops would rather not switch suppliers mid-season, and honestly, neither would we. Numbers are in the appendix. The strategic context you'll want for negotiations is below.

confidential, kagep-kahof: Druokax Systems plans to lower the Ulaath list price by 53 percent in March.